当前位置: 首页 > 知识库问答 >
问题:

如何在CPP中命名选项卡/列?

羿经武
2023-03-14

我是个新的编码器。不是真正的编码器,但只是一个大学一年级(第一学期)的学生。所以请原谅我如果这是个愚蠢的问题....如何在CPP中命名选项卡或列?我要做一个程序,收集我班上学生的名字,以及他们的电子邮件、电话和CGPA。我必须在一个选项卡中打印代码,我做了,但我想知道我如何命名选项卡,就像在“名称”下,它将是所有学生的名字,在“电子邮件”下,将是所有学生的电子邮件等,在一个垂直列表视图...

这是密码;

#include <iostream>
#include <conio.h>
using namespace std;

struct Student
{
  string name;
  string email;
  string phone;
  double cgpa;
};

int main(void)
{
  

  Student students[3];
  double sum=0.0;
  double avg=0.0;

  for (int i=0; i<3; i++)
  {
    cout<<"\nPlease enter name"<<endl;
    cin>>students[i].name;
    cout<<"\nPlease enter email"<<endl;
    cin>>students[i].email;
    cout<<"\nPlease enter phone"<<endl;
    cin>>students[i].phone;
    cout<<"\nPlease enter cgpa"<<endl;
    cin>>students[i].cgpa;
  }
    cout<<""<<endl;
    cout<<"Printing student info\n--------------"<<endl;
   
    for(int i=0; i<3; i++)
    {
        cout<<students[i].name<<"\t"<<students[i].email<<"\t"<<students[i].phone<<"\t"<<students[i].cgpa<<"\t"<<endl;
    }

    for (int i=0; i<3; i++)
    {
        sum+=students[i].cgpa;
    }
    avg=sum/3;
    cout<<"The average cgpa of the students = "<<avg;

getch();
}

共有1个答案

司寇琨
2023-03-14

打印学生信息之前:

cout<<"Name\tEmail\tPhone\tcgpa\t"<<endl;

之所以有列,只是因为你要打印出一些列。如果你打印出一些,就会有标题。

 类似资料:
  • 当我像下面的例子一样点击选项卡2时,我如何将选项卡1 Neumorphic css翻译成选项卡2呢,就像从选项卡1滑到选项卡2一样? https://dribble.com/shots/10805627-neumorphic-tab

  • 我正在学习本教程中的示例。根据教程,我想在两个选项卡之间拖动选项卡。到目前为止,我设法创建了这段代码,但我需要一些帮助才能完成代码。 来源 将选项卡的内容作为对象插入的正确方法是什么?简单的文本被转移到教程中。我必须如何修改这行< code>content.put(DataFormat。PLAIN_TEXT,tab pane);? 拖动选项卡后插入选项卡的正确方法是什么: 目的地 我想这个转移可以

  • 页边距在它们之间的选项卡和选定的选项卡上有一个勾号

  • 问题内容: 我们开发了一个Chrome扩展程序,我想用Selenium测试我们的扩展程序。我创建了一个测试,但是问题是我们的扩展程序在安装后会打开一个新选项卡,我认为我从另一个选项卡中得到了例外。是否可以切换到我正在测试的活动标签?另一个选择是先禁用扩展名,然后登录到我们的网站,然后再启用该扩展名。可能吗?这是我的代码: 测试失败,原因是,因为在新选项卡(由扩展名打开)中,“登录”不可见(我认为仅

  • Resharper在一个类中有这个新的选项卡键规则,当选项卡时,它会将选项卡转换为导航到代码的下一部分,但不会在它们之间添加选项卡行间距。有人知道如何禁用这个吗?

  • 在新版本的Visual Studio代码中,默认情况下会呈现选项卡。我如何禁用/隐藏它们,因为我非常喜欢没有任何选项卡的前一个行为?